I believe, and I may be wrong, but lovebirds may need to be DNA sexed for accuracy. I had a pair of siblings years ago, and we never did know the exact sex of each. Where as finches (many) species have a visual distinction either shuttle or obvious between male and female, it is difficult to tell with lovebirds.
